Candidate Analysis Requirements
Optimizing the success of laser vision Correction counts on a comprehensive evaluation of candidate requirements. To identify if you're a suitable candidate for laser vision Correction, several key variables will be evaluated.
Your age and eye health are essential factors to consider. Generally, prospects ought to be over 18 years old with stable vision for at the very least a year. Your glasses or call lens prescription will certainly likewise play a significant function in establishing candidateship.
The thickness of your cornea and the shape of your eye will be examined to ensure the procedure can be securely executed. Additionally, any kind of existing eye conditions or wellness concerns will be considered during the assessment procedure.
It's necessary to go over any kind of past eye surgical treatments or clinical problems with your eye treatment supplier to determine if laser vision Correction is a feasible alternative for you. By very carefully reviewing these criteria, your eye treatment provider can determine if laser vision Correction is the ideal selection for you.
